Intakes for a 2003 G35?
 
Does anybody know any current intakes out for this car?


Merlin 10-07-2002 08:30 AM

Re: Intakes for a 2003 G35?
 
Blitz makes an intake and rear exhaust. But the rear exhaust makes you lose low end torque. K&N is testing and developing a intake system. G35Spot, you can check with him.

I've looked into the Blitz product line, and the stainless air filter for their intake kit allows far too many contaminants to pass through it.

The K&N kit should make at least the same horsepower, if not more, But it has the high quality K&N filter that has been proven to keep your engine clean....

No matter how much I want more power, I will wait for the K&N intake kit.

For the time being, I have installed the K&N stock replacement filter. It pops right into the stock airbox, and allows for better air intake, while keeping the nasties out of your engine......
